Grails Index 简易产生批量命令
写好了domain后,基本上就要靠scaffold批量生成页面了。每次一个一个输入命令太麻烦。
于是修改index.gsp中的<div id="page-body" role="main">,然后运行起来,copy内容到dos窗口,稍微省了点儿事儿。
<div id="page-body" role="main"><H1>Create Service</H1><g:each in="${grailsApplication.domainClasses }" var="domainClassInstance"><g:if test="${domainClassInstance.fullName.startsWith('com.myapp') }"><p>call grails create-service ${domainClassInstance.fullName }</p></g:if></g:each><h1>Generate All</h1><g:each in="${grailsApplication.domainClasses }" var="domainClassInstance"><g:if test="${domainClassInstance.fullName.startsWith('com.myapp') }"><p>call grails generate-all ${domainClassInstance.fullName }</p></g:if></g:each></div>